To meet the user demand for an ever-increasing mobile-cloud computing performance for resource-intensive mobile applications, we propose a new service architecture called Acceleration as a Service (AXaaS). We formulate AXaaS based on the observation that most resource-intensive applications, such as real-time face-recognition and augmented reality, have similar resource-demand characteristics: a vast majority of the program execution time is spent on a limited set of library calls, such as Generalized Matrix-Multiply operations (GEMM), or FFT. Our AXaaS model suggests accelerating only these operations by the Telecom Service Providers (TSP). We envision the TSP offering this service through a monthly computational service charge, much like their existing monthly bandwidth charge. We demonstrate the technological and business feasibility of AXaaS on a proof-of-concept real-time face recognition application. We elaborate on the consumer, developer, and the TSP view of this model. Our results confirm AXaaS as a novel and viable business model.

With the development of the Internet of Things (IoT), the number of drones, as a consumer-level IoT device, is rapidly increasing. The existence of a large number of drones increases the risk of misoperation during manual control. Therefore, it has become an inevitable trend to realize drone flying automation. Drone flying automation mainly relies on massive drone applications and services as well as third-party service providers, which not only complicate the drone network service environment but also raise some security and privacy issues. To address these challenges, this article proposes an innovative architecture called Secure Drone Network Edge Service (SDNES), which integrates edge computing and blockchain into the drone network to provide real-time and reliable network services for drones. To design a feasible and rational SDNES architecture, we first consider the real-time performance and apply edge computing technology in it to provide low-latency edge services for drones under 5G mobile network. We use DAG-based blockchain to guarantee the security and reliability of the drone network service environment and effectively avoid malicious behaviors. In order to illustrate the feasibility of this architecture, we design and implement a specific service case named Drone Collision Avoidance Navigation Service based on SDNES. Finally, a simulation experiment for the specific service case and a series of other performance-related experiments were carried out to verify the feasibility and rationality of our proposed architecture. The experimental results demonstrate that SDNES is a promising architecture to assist and accelerate drone flying automation.

Face recognition is a challenging task for the researches. It is very useful for personal verification and recognition and also it is very difficult to implement due to all different situation that a human face can be found. This system makes use of the face recognition approach for the computerized attendance marking of students or employees in the room environment without lectures intervention or the employee. This system is very efficient and requires very less maintenance compared to the traditional methods. Among existing methods PCA is the most efficient technique. In this project Holistic based approach is adapted. The system is implemented using MATLAB and provides high accuracy.

Telecom industry is one of those industries which has changed dramatically during the past decade. With more and more players entering in this industry, competition is ever increasing. The war between these players is slowly shifting from the price to the augmentation. This paper aims at exploring such factors which influence a customers preference of one telecom service provider (TSP) over the other. It is a descriptive research where study has been conducted among the consumers of different telecom service providers (TSPs). By reviewing the existing literature in this domain, we explored different factors which affect the consumers decision to prefer one telecom service provider over the other. A consumer targeted questionnaire was designed where consumers were asked about the factors they consider (with their relative importance quantified using Likert scale), before buying a new network connection to know the relative importance of the various factors. Factor Analysis was performed to club various variables into distinct factors. Statistical techniques then helped in identifying the relative importance. From the Factor Loading matrix the following five factors were generated:- Overall service quality, Point of Purchase Differentiator, Promotion Measures, Tariff Plans and Size of the Network. Further study in the behavioural perceptions of consumer shows that the most important factor in influencing the customer buying behavior is Service Quality. The second most important factor is cost and various plans offered by the telecom service provider. Network connectivity was considered by almost all the respondents and consumers prefer the largest network player. The study also found that promotional measures dont influence the customers as expected.

Objective of the study is to make a comparative analysis of customer satisfaction of different Telecom Service Providers in Haryana along with identification of factors which influence customer satisfaction. After completing extensive literature review, eight attributes  namely ‘attractive offers’, ‘using advanced technology’, ‘mobile provider being friendly’, ‘reliability’, ‘promptness of response’,  ‘it delivers promises, it makes’, ‘availability’ and ‘network’ are identified influencing customers satisfaction. Survey method was adopted for the study. 250 respondents of different TSP’s covering all Telecom Districts in Haryana. SPSS 21.0 was applied for analysis of the collected data. Statistical tools namely Descriptive Analysis, Frequency Analysis, Cross-Tabs Analysis and One Way ANOVA were used in the research study. After systematic analysis and findings of the study, it is found that highest percentage of respondents are satisfied with the attributes namely ‘attractive offers’, ‘mobile provider being friendly’, ‘availability’ and ‘network’ of Airtel along with ‘reliability’ and ‘it delivers promises, it makes’ of Vodafone-Idea, ‘promptness of response’ of BSNL and ‘using advanced technology’ of Reliance-Jio. It is also revealed from the study that Airtel is required to improve ‘reliability’ and ‘availability’ of its mobile networks. Vodafone-Idea needs to improve upon the attributes ‘attractive offers’, ‘using advanced technology’, ‘mobile provider being friendly’ and ‘network’. BSNL may further improve ‘promptness of response’ and Reliance-Jio needs to show improvement about ‘it delivers promises, it makes’. It is concluded from the research study that services of Airtel are preferred by maximum percentage of respondents.
